Abstract:
The present invention provides methods for detecting insulin autoantibody. Such methods can be used, for example, to predict susceptibility of and/or diagnose the presence of Type 1 diabetes in a subject. Some aspects of the invention also provide kits adapted for use in such methods. In particular, some aspects of the invention use proinsulin to detect the presence of insulin autoantibody.

Abstract:
The present invention is directed to therapeutic compositions and methods for the prevention or treatment of autoimmune diseases, comprising molecules that disrupt or prevent the assembly of the trimolecular complex required for the T cell immune response comprising the autoantigen, the MHC class II molecule, and the T cell receptor implicated in the autoimmune disease.

Abstract:
The invention provides methods of preventing, treating or ameliorating autoimmune diseases such as diabetes by modulating the binding of MHC class II molecules to antigenic peptides or fragments of antigenic peptides of the autoimmune disease by the administration of small organic compounds. The invention also provides pharmaceutical compositions comprising the therapeutically effective small organic compounds and methods of using the same.
